When attending a winery tasting, attempt to limit the variety of wines you pattern in a single visit. Sampling too many wines can overwhelm your senses and make it difficult to appreciate particular person characteristics. As An Alternative, focus on a select few that pique your interest. This method allows for a extra thorough tasting experience, enabling you to establish the nuances in flavor and aroma without distractions.


Embrace the concept of a flight—a pre-selected grouping of wines meant to be skilled together. Many wineries supply themed flights, which showcase particular varietals, vintages, and even regional styles. Opting for a flight can provide a guided experience that permits you to higher perceive the differences among the wines (Wineries That Offer Dog Friendly Areas). This curated selection can facilitate comparisons, making every tasting more insightful.


While exploring completely different wines, additionally take note of the wine’s look, aroma, and style. Take a moment to observe its shade and readability in the glass earlier than taking a sip. Swirl the wine gently to launch its bouquet and inhale the aromas. Do not rush this process; allowing the wine to breathe can considerably improve its flavors.

What is the ideal variety of wines to incorporate in a tasting?undefinedAn ideal tasting typically features 4 to 6 wines. This quantity permits visitors to appreciate every wine without becoming overwhelmed. It’s additionally clever to include a stability of different sorts or styles to keep the tasting interesting and academic.


How can I put together my palate before a winery tasting?undefinedTo prepare your palate, keep hydrated and avoid heavy meals simply before the tasting. Remarkable Craft Wineries In Sebastopol. Think About tasting neutral snacks like crackers or bread to cleanse your palate between different wines. Taking small sips and allowing the wine to linger also can enhance your tasting experience.
